Sleep is so very important for not only those who are hoping to gain more height but for everyone.
When we sleep is when our bodies do their best to repair and replace the cells and allow us to grow.
It starts from when we are born till the day we die.
As children our parents make us go to bed early so we get 8, 9 or 10 hours sleep.
This is good because this would be our best years for growing in size.
But as we get older and nobody tells us to go to bed we tend to stay up later and later getting less sleep.
As adults our lives can get very busy when we take on more of a work load, spending time with family and all of the other responsibilities we are faced with.
We rob our bodies of the most important time to rebuild and energize ourselves and we eventually pay for this in our older age.
If you have adolescent kids, make sure they get lots of sleep at night so they can take full advantage of this important time in their lives to grow.
As they get out of their teen years the growth hormones start to be less helpful so make use of those adolescent years.
As adults we need all the help we can get to maintain our ability to rebuild our bodies.
Try your best to get at least eight hours of sleep each night and you will feel better.
You will also be fulfilling one of the important steps to help fend off losing your height as you move into older age.
